

A young woman, struggling with agoraphobia, hasn't left her New York apartment or seen anyone in over a year. However, when her toilet overflows, she is forced to call in the plumber.

Trivia, insights & behind the scenes
Director Noah Buschel shot in his actual apartment, using real locations to create authentic spatial anxiety.
The entire film was improvised from a 20-page outline; Marin Ireland and Paul Sparks developed their characters' backstories together over weeks.
